Norwood Junction is equipped with essential amenities designed to accommodate a wide range of passenger needs. If you're planning to buy or collect train tickets, you’ll find a conveniently located ticket office, open every day from early morning until late evening. For those preferring automated methods, ticket machines are available 24/7, with accessibility features designed for ease of use. It's worth noting that smartcards cannot be issued or validated at this station.
For passenger assistance, staff are available throughout most of the day, every day of the week. While the station lacks a dedicated waiting room, there are seating areas for travelers to use as they await their trains. Although there are refreshments available — including a coffee shop on Platform 1 and a kiosk on Platforms 4/5 — shoppers might find the retail offering rather limited.
In terms of accessibility, step-free access is available though somewhat limited — with platform connections facilitated via a subway with steps. For accessible travel, nearby stations like Anerley, West Norwood, or East Croydon may be more suitable options.
Norwood Junction also offers various onward travel options. For local bus services, you can utilize bus stops on Selhurst Road to connect to destinations such as East Croydon and Sutton or head towards Balham and London Bridge. If you prefer a more personalized journey, taxis can be arranged through services like Addison Lee or Gett.

The station provides comprehensive facilities to ensure a hassle-free travel experience. For ticket purchases, an office is open from 06:20 to 19:45 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 09:10 to 16:45 on Sundays. Ticket machines are also available, offering the convenience of collecting online tickets. Note that these machines support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
Accessibility is central, with step-free access throughout this Category A station. Although accessible toilets aren't available, assistance points and well-trained staff ensure support for all travelers during operating hours. For parking, there are 94 spaces available free-of-charge, making this a feasible option for those driving to the station.
Beyond rail, Horley is well-connected with various transport links. An active taxi rank is right outside the station, ready to whisk travelers away to their next destination, which could be the nearby airport or local attractions. Rail replacement and local bus services expand options for travelers looking to explore Surrey and beyond.
